Description

Key Performance Areas

Task/Responsibilities
Game Drives

  • Guiding guests on game drive in an open game drive vehicle.
  • Hosting of guests between game drives.
  • Time Management being on time for daily duties.
  • If any changes need to be made regarding game drives, the ranger must get permission from the head ranger and inform him/her of the exact changes
  • Any duties/tasks done outside game drives; the head ranger needs to be advised hereof.
  • Game Drive vehicles are not to be driven unnecessarily.
  • Game Drive vehicles are not to be driven without permission from the head ranger.
  • All game drive vehicle keys are to be returned to the head ranger, after game drive.
  • Afternoon game drive commences, guests that are MIA are to be looked for.
  • Morning game drives: guests MIA are to be left alone and at peace.
  • Do not convoy drive different routes.
  • No off roading in the reserve to get better sightings of game.
  • Game drive vehicle rules are to be always obeyed.
  • Game drives are to be a memorable African experience for guests. Guests are to be educated on the importance of wildlife heritage and the protection thereof.
  • Morning game drive: Tea, coffee, and snacks to be provided to guests before game drive.
  • Game drive blankets to be taken to laundry after every morning drive.
  • Game drive vehicles to be washed and sanitised before every drive.
Guests

  • Listen to guests
  • Always talk to guests in a calm, collective manner.
  • Answer guests' questions as best as possible.
  • Do not argue with guests.
  • Guest happiness comes first.
  • Guest safety comes first. Guests are not to be exposed to any situation that may place their lives in danger or make them feel uncomfortable.
  • Always give feedback with regards to guest's experience, to the Head Ranger or General Manager
  • Pronouncing and using guest's names when addressing the appropriate guest
  • Communicate with guests and handle any problems that may occur
Protection of Eco-system

  • Range the bushveld and protect every aspect that may affect the sensitive balance of a selfsufficient ecosystem.
  • Educate others about the importance of protecting the ecosystem.
  • No driving around water puddles.
  • Obey roads that are closed off with rocks.
  • Do not drive pipeline roads.
  • Report any broken water pipes to the Reserve Manager or Head Ranger.
